What is the approximate side length of a square game board with an area of 109 in ​

Mathematics
1 answer:
erma4kov [3.2K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

10.4 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

The side lengths of a square are all equal. The formula to find the area of a square given a side length s is s².

s² = 109

Taking the square root gives us approximately 10.4 inches.
